Understanding Divorce in Texas: The Structure
Prior to delving right into the specifics of a Denton Texas separation, it's vital to realize the fundamental legislations governing marital relationship dissolution throughout the Lone Star State. Texas supplies both "no-fault" and "fault-based" premises for separation:
No-Fault Separation (Insupportability): One of the most commonalities, asserting that the marital relationship has come to be "insupportable" due to disharmony or problem, without sensible assumption of reconciliation. This prevents criticizing either celebration and often causes a much less controversial procedure.
Fault-Based Separation: While less usual for the whole separation, Texas regulation additionally identifies mistake grounds, which can often influence home division or spousal upkeep. These include adultery, cruelty, desertion (for a minimum of one year), felony sentence (with jail time for a minimum of one year), and arrest in a mental hospital (for at least 3 years with long shot of recovery).
Residency Requirements
To apply for separation in Texas, details residency needs must be met:
At least one partner has to have lived in Texas for a continuous six-month duration.
Furthermore, at least one partner has to have resided in the area where the separation is declared at the very least 90 days. This implies if you are declaring a Denton Area separation, either you or your spouse need to have stayed in Denton County for a minimum of 90 days.
The Denton County Divorce Refine: What to Expect
Once residency requirements are fulfilled, the Denton Region divorce procedure begins with submitting the preliminary documentation.
1. Submitting the Request
The primary step is to file an "Original Request for Separation" with the Area Staff's office in Denton Region. Since 2025, the declaring fee is normally in between $350 and $400, though it's constantly recommended to verify the precise amount with the Area Staff's office, situated at 1450 E McKinney Street, 1st Flooring, Denton, TX 76209. E-filing is likewise an readily available and progressively typical approach for sending documents.
2. Solution of Process
After the application is filed, your spouse has to be formally alerted of the divorce procedures. This is referred to as "service of procedure." Alternatives consist of:
Formal Solution: Used by a constable, sheriff, or private process-server.
Licensed Mail: Documents sent by means of certified mail with a return receipt.
Waiver of Service: If your partner consents to the separation and works together, Denton County divorce they can authorize a Waiver of Service, staying clear of the demand for formal solution and often speeding up the process.
3. The Mandatory Waiting Period
Texas legislation mandates a 60-day waiting duration from the day the Original Petition for Separation is submitted before a separation can be wrapped up. This duration allows pairs time to reconsider, bargain terms, or wrap up contracts without unnecessary haste. Also in one of the most amicable and uncontested cases, this 60-day minimum should be observed.
4. Exploration and Info Gathering
During the separation procedure, both parties take part in "discovery," which involves exchanging economic and individual information appropriate to the separation. This can consist of:
Financial declarations, bank accounts, investments
Property deeds, car titles
Financial obligation statements (mortgages, bank card, financings).
Details related to kids ( clinical, institution documents).
Complete disclosure is important in Texas, a area building state. All possessions and financial obligations obtained during the marriage are thought about neighborhood property and undergo a just and fair division by the court. Trying to conceal assets can result in serious charges from the court.
5. Short-term Orders.
Oftentimes, especially those entailing children or complicated economic situations, the court may release "Temporary Orders" early at the same time. These orders develop regulations for youngster wardship, visitation, child assistance, spousal support, and momentary use of residential or commercial property while the divorce is pending. They ensure security and supply a framework for daily life during the often-lengthy divorce process.
6. Arrangement and Arbitration.
Many divorces in Denton Area, and Texas as a whole, are fixed with negotiation and arbitration instead of a complete trial.
Arrangement: Spouses ( typically via their attorneys) work to reach shared arrangements on all aspects of the divorce.
Mediation: A neutral third-party moderator promotes conversations in between the partners, helping them locate common ground and get to a equally appropriate negotiation. Mediation is frequently mandatory in opposed instances and is extremely efficient in settling conflicts agreeably, which can conserve time, money, and psychological tension.
7. The Final Decree of Divorce and Prove-Up.
If spouses get to a complete agreement, they will certainly authorize an "Agreed Mandate of Divorce." This thorough document describes all terms, including youngster guardianship and assistance setups, spousal upkeep ( spousal support), and the division of community home and financial debts.
When the 60-day waiting period has passed and all terms are agreed upon, the instance continues to a "Prove-Up" hearing. For uncontested separations in Denton Area, these hearings are frequently brief and can often be submitted online without the requirement for an in-person court appearance. The court examines the Agreed Decree to ensure it complies with Texas law and is in the best rate of interest of any youngsters involved. Upon approval, the judge indications the Final Decree of Separation, officially liquifying the marital relationship.
Browsing Your Denton Area Separation: Support and Options.
The trip via divorce in Denton County can be overwhelming, yet you do not have to face it alone.
Uncontested Separation Services: If you and your spouse can settle on all terms, solutions concentrating on uncontested divorces can give considerable cost financial savings and a faster resolution. These services often aid with preparing all essential documents and leading you through the declaring and completion steps.
Legal Representation: For even more complicated or opposed divorces, hiring an lawyer is extremely advised. A skilled family law lawyer can support for your civil liberties, guide you via discovery, work out in your place, and represent you in court if a negotiation can not be gotten to.
Self-Representation (Pro Se): While feasible, filing for divorce without legal guidance can be difficult, especially if small kids or significant properties are included. Resources like TexasLawHelp.org offer types and instructions for those selecting this course, but they don't use lawful guidance.
